Transcription: |
PG 695 9) 10) 11) Clay pot too broken to be typed 12) Copper bowl, hemispherical diam 0105 III U.9697 13) Copper Axe [drawing (artifact:tool)] l. 013 wt 007 U.9692 14) Copper Reticule U.9695 15) Cylinder Seal, green stone w copper caps U.9694 16) Cylinder seal, lapis w gold caps U.9693 17) but - 2 cylinder 3 lapis lentoid beads, 1 carn, car, & beaded [agati?] & this on gold ball U.9696 18) Silver earring, decayed. 19) Remnants of a small wooden object the face of which had been carved & the hollows filled in with bright red pigment nothing more carved made of it |
